My 6 yr old and urinary issues

My 6 yr old daughter still wears pullups to bed. I've tried letting her go without it, but she wet the bed every night so we went back to it. Here lately, though. she has started wetting herself during the day, sayins she didnt get to the bathroom in time, but it doesent seem to be a big issue to her. She has always had severe meltdowns over anything. What may cause her to just start wetting herself?

Since she's just recently started wetting herself during the day,  this is probably behavioral.  For some reason she no longer cares all that much if she pees on herself.   If you've had her checked for a UTI,  you can be pretty sure she just has decided it's not all that important to use the toilet.    It won't be long before other kids start to make fun of her if she's doing this at school and maybe that will help her - otherwise,  returning to the routine of forcing her to go to the potty every so often the way you do preschoolers would probably help.

The night time wetting is probably different - she really can't help that.  We had to "walk" my oldest son every single night - around 1 a.m. - to the bathroom until he was about 7 or he'd likely have an accident.  Deep sleep,  or something.
